Index: content/shell/shell_content_browser_client.cc |
diff --git a/content/shell/shell_content_browser_client.cc b/content/shell/shell_content_browser_client.cc |
index a97abf53e817d64533da8e926236697225cf54e0..0176c2b4b213a489287c14a4493e42ba4697f2a6 100644 |
--- a/content/shell/shell_content_browser_client.cc |
+++ b/content/shell/shell_content_browser_client.cc |
@@ -28,9 +28,10 @@ ShellContentBrowserClient::ShellContentBrowserClient() |
ShellContentBrowserClient::~ShellContentBrowserClient() { |
} |
-BrowserMainParts* ShellContentBrowserClient::CreateBrowserMainParts( |
- const MainFunctionParams& parameters) { |
- return new ShellBrowserMainParts(parameters); |
+void ShellContentBrowserClient::CreateBrowserMainParts( |
+ const MainFunctionParams& parameters, |
+ std::vector<BrowserMainParts*>* parts_list) { |
+ parts_list->push_back(new ShellBrowserMainParts(parameters)); |
} |
RenderWidgetHostView* ShellContentBrowserClient::CreateViewForWidget( |